With the first pole position for Porsche this season, Pascal Wehrlein already set an exclamation point in qualifying. After initially leading the 2.606-kilometer course, which runs through the famous baseball stadium Foto Sol with its unique stadium atmosphere, he was third halfway through the distance. His teammate André Lotterer, who had started the race from third place, followed in fourth. The leading group was close together. But in the final phase, the perfect race strategy of the TAG Heuer Porsche Formula E team and optimal energy management had an impact. Wehrlein first moved up to second place and shortly afterwards took the lead – followed by Lotterer, who had started the race from third place on the grid. At the finish, the two Porsche 99X Electric were almost ten seconds ahead of their pursuers.
